#d18514 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d18514 is composed of 82% red, 52.2%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.4% magenta, 90.4%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 35.9 degrees, a saturation of 82.5% and a lightness of 44.9%. #d18514 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ff28 with #a30b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#d18514 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d18514 has RGB values of R:209, G:133,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.9,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13731092.
